Oil central heating and electric fire in sitting room. Electric oven and hob, microwave, fridge, freezer, dishwasher, washing machine and tumble dryer, additional fridge and freezer in garage, picnic basket and cool bag. 2 x TV’s, 1 Smart TV with Freeview, WiFi, Blu-ray player, small selection of books, puzzles, games and DVDs. Fuel and power inc. in rent. Bed linen and towels inc. in rent (please bring own beach towels). Travel cot (no bedding) and highchair available. Off-road parking for one car with additional roadside parking available. Secure garage for bikes/canoes etc. Side patio with dining table and chairs and rear garden with furniture. Sorry, no pets and no smoking. Shop 0.5 miles, pub 0.4 miles. Large sandy beach in walking distance. Please note: Bookings are only taken from Saturday to Saturday for 7 nights.
